Perrigo 2.5% Benzoyl Peroxide Acne Treatment Gel is a topical, leave-on gel formulated to help reduce acne blemishes with a low-strength 2.5% benzoyl peroxide concentration.

This single-ingredient acne treatment from Perrigo uses 2.5% benzoyl peroxide in a clear gel base designed for spot treatment or thin application across oily, blemish-prone areas. The formula is presented in a 60 g squeezable tube for controlled dosing and convenient travel storage. It aims to deliver antimicrobial activity on the skin surface while allowing gradual use to evaluate tolerance, particularly for those new to benzoyl peroxide products.

How should I apply this gel to my skin?

Apply to clean, dry skin once daily to start, then increase frequency to twice daily if tolerated. Use a pea-sized amount for spot treatment or a thin layer for larger areas, avoiding eyes, mouth, and broken skin. Always follow with a moisturizer and sunscreen during the day.

  • Apply after cleansing and drying the affected area
  • Start with once-daily application; increase if no irritation
  • Avoid contact with eyes and mucous membranes
  • Use non-comedogenic moisturizer to reduce dryness

What results can I expect and when might I see them?

Individual responses vary, but some users notice improvement in the appearance of blemishes within a few days to weeks. Consistent, correct application is key; benzoyl peroxide works by reducing bacteria on the skin surface and helping to clear pores. Results build over several weeks with regular use as part of a simple skincare routine.

  • Initial improvement sometimes within days
  • More visible clearing typically over several weeks
  • Best used consistently for sustained benefit
  • Monitor skin for dryness or irritation

Is 2.5% benzoyl peroxide strong enough for acne control?

Lower concentrations like 2.5% can be effective while generally causing less irritation than higher strengths. It’s a reasonable starting point for those with mild to moderate blemishes or sensitive skin who want to test tolerance. If needed, higher concentrations or alternative therapies can be considered under guidance.

  • 2.5% balances efficacy and tolerability
  • Good option for sensitive or first-time users
  • Can be incorporated with gentle cleansers and moisturizers
  • Consult a clinician for persistent or severe acne

How do I store and handle the tube safely?

Keep the 60 g tube capped and stored at room temperature away from direct sunlight. Benzoyl peroxide can bleach fabrics, so allow the gel to dry fully before contact with clothing or bedding. Dispose of packaging responsibly when empty.

  • Store upright in a cool, dry place
  • Beware of bleaching on towels and clothing
  • Keep out of reach of children and pets
  • Replace cap after each use to maintain product integrity

Q: Can I use Perrigo 2.5% gel every day?

A: Start once daily and increase to twice daily if no irritation; monitor skin and use moisturizer.

Q: Will this product bleach my clothes?

A: Yes, benzoyl peroxide can bleach fabrics; let the gel dry completely before clothing contact.
